Geggy Tah
This super talented trio from the inland empire of southern
California, were, in my opinion, torn asunder by their own insanity
and the machinations of Virgin, who rightly heard the incredible songs
that Tommy Jordan and the others were writing and imagined hit singles
(they'd already had a minor hit with "Whoever You Are".) Upon
delivering their last record they were met with the usual major label
demand to "go back and record some singles" — with the implicit
promise that more "support" would result, which ended up simply
dragging out the record completion process for almost a year. By the
time the wonderful Into The Oh came out the band didn't exist — a
great shame, as this is still one of my favorite records, whether it
was on Luaka or not. Tommy was deeply in love and the songs reflect
his ecstasy in unclichéd and imaginative ways.
